Alphabetical Reference
FTP
Abbreviation for "File Transfer Protocol".
Used for transferring files in networks, for example to update telephone
software
G.711
Audio protocol for uncompressed voice transmission. Requires a
bandwidth of 64 kbit/s.
G.722
Audio protocol for uncompressed voice transmission. Requires a
bandwidth of 128 kbit/s. This voice transmission supplies the best quality.
